"There are two basic types of land ownership in India - Patta and Peremboke; Patta land is privately owned and can be sold and purchased freely. Peremboke land is government owned property given to poor farmers to grow crops on or to live on. Farmers can pass peremboke land to their children to continue to farm from generation to generation, but they cannot sell it. It is a crime to do so and a crime to purchase it." A patta is a legal document in India for land, similar to a deed for property in the U.S. A patta should be drawn up no matter if the property is purchased or inherited, or no matter if the property is just land or land with a building/buildings on it. The only requirements required are that you be the owner of property.

For getting patta for Natham lands one has to apply to the Thahsildar for natham lands along with proof of possession and enjoyment , he will enquirer in to the matter and wiil sent a notice of inquiry and after elaborate inquiry if he is satisfied that the natham land is in possession and enjoyment of the applicant he will issue patta. Assignment patta is a legal document that establishes the transfer of rights, typically related to land or property, from one party to another. It acts as evidence of the change in ownership and is crucial for official records and transactions.
For Patta:Seller should have the valid patta for the land that he is selling on his name, and once it is sold you have to apply for patta on your name and get it. Since we are buying land from real estate developers, they do it for us (i.e apply for patta and get it in our name, for which they charge the documentation or other charges). If you were to buy land from a private seller then you would have to apply for patta on your name, after you have purchased the land. And that involves visiting the local govt office and bribing them etc.Chitta Adangal are two seperate documents.Adangal - This document will be with VAO (Village Administrator Officer), and also a copy in taluka office. This will contain details such as survey number, who is the current owner, size of the plot etc. Before you purchase you need to verify this document and also after purchase this document will be sent to you as a copy. For example, after the registration on SHN along with the other documents this will also be sent to you.Chitta - This document will also be with VAO and a copy of this in taluka office. This document will contain details such as what are the surroundings on the four side of your plot. For example it will say 'to the North, there is a 23 ft road', 'to the south plot owned by Mr x', etc. Dimensions of the four sides etc. Again same as Chitta, you verify this before you buy land and also after you buy (i.e you register) you should get a copy of the Adangal document for your plot. This typically is sent by the real estate developers along with other property documents.
